Parks, Recreation & Leisure Studies is the 218th most popular major in the country with 3,106 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.

Across the Great Lakes region, there were 475 parks, recreation and leisure stud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 358 parks, recreation and leisure stud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$40,343 and $26,790 respectively.

This year’s “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Parks & Rec Major in the Great Lakes Region” ranking looked at 19 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in parks, recreation and leisure studies. That schools that top this list have a program in parks, recreation and leisure studies in which the largest percentage of students at the school are enrolled.
